Default What brushless motors are Roar legal?

what brushless motors are roar approved and for what class?
27t stock? 19t? mod?

same idea but different what are local tracks allowing to run and for what class?

Here is a list of approved motors for ROAR:

http://www.roarracing.com/approvals/smotor.php

Only Modified allows brushless motors.

Stock and 19t do not allow brushless motors.

At SRS during club nights I have been allowing any brushless in Modified...

For 19 turn we allow nothing lower than a 10.5

For Stock we allow nothing lower than a 13.5.

Again this is for club racing only.

For our big races we generally follow ROAR guidelines.

There really isn't a true brushless equivalent for stock and 19t, the ones Orange listed above are close but the brushless have the advantage. Probably why ROAR uses handout Stock and 19t motors. Mod is really the only class that is open to most every motor
